Question 8

Answer the following questions relating to time value of money:

(a) Alexandria has just been awarded a scholarship that will pay her $28,500 per year for the next four years as she pursues her undergraduate studies overseas. Using a discount rate of 9% per annum, what is the value of these payments today? (3 marks)

(b) Jo will be retiring today. The company which Jo works for is offering him a gratuity in recognition of his long service with the company.

Jo has been given the following payout options: Option 1: Receive a lump sum payment of $2,150,000 in twelve years time. Option 2: Receive $115,000 payment per year for the next twelve years.

Given that the interest rate is at 8 percent per year, which alternative would provide Jo with the highest payout based on the present value? (Provide the computation for each of the options.

(c) Robert purchased a new apartment for $980,000. He paid $250,000 in cash and agreed to pay the remaining balance over the next 20 years in 20 equal annual payments. The interest charged is fixed at 4% per annum compounded annually. How much will these equal annual payments be?

(d) Compute the present value for the following cash flow stream if the business uses a discount rate of 14%:
